ASTM A563

ASTM A563 is the standard specification that defines the chemical and mechanical requirements for carbon steel and alloy steel nuts used with bolts, studs, and other externally threaded fasteners. This specification ensures that nuts meet the required strength, performance, and compatibility for industrial applications.

Key Highlights of ASTM A563:

Nut Compatibility: The specification outlines which nut grades are suitable for different grades of bolts. (See Nut Compatibility Chart for reference).

Flexibility in Supply: In cases where a particular nut grade is not readily available in certain sizes or finishes, the supplier may provide nuts from a stronger grade—provided the purchaser is notified and has not restricted such substitution in the purchase order.

Substitution Option: ASTM A194 Grade 2H nuts can be supplied in place of A563 Grade DH nuts for sizes 3/4? and larger, since Grade DH nuts are often unavailable in those dimensions.

Hot-Dip Galvanized Nuts: These nuts must be tapped oversize to account for the added zinc coating on the threads. The standard provides detailed oversize tapping allowances, ensuring proper fit and function.

Nut Styles Covered:

Depending on the grade, various nut styles fall under ASTM A563, including:

• Hex nuts

• Heavy hex nuts

• Square nuts

• Jam nuts

• Coupling nuts

• Sleeve nuts

This standard plays a critical role in maintaining consistency, safety, and reliability in fastener assemblies used across industries.

A563 Grades: 

Grade Description
A Carbon steel, hex or heavy hex
B Carbon steel, hex or heavy hex
C Carbon steel, quenched and tempered, heavy hex
D Carbon steel, quenched and tempered, heavy hex
DH Carbon steel, quenched and tempered, heavy hex
C3 Weathering steel, quenched and tempered, heavy hex
DH3 Weathering steel, quenched and tempered, heavy hex

A563 Mechanical Properties:

Grade Style Size, in. Proof Load, ksi Hardness, HBN
Plain Galvanized
A Hex 1/4" - 1-1/2" 90 68 116 - 302
Heavy Hex 1/4" - 4" 100 75 116 - 302
B Heavy Hex 1/4" - 1" 133 100 121 - 302
Heavy Hex 1-1/8" - 1-1/2" 116 87 121 - 302
C / C3 Heavy Hex 1/4" - 4" 144 144 143 - 352
D Heavy Hex 1/4" - 4" 150 150 248 - 352
DH / DH3 Heavy Hex 1/4" - 4" 175 150 248 - 352
